To listen to how speakers really sound in your own room, the only way is to install in your room and listen. The acoustics of the listening room in a sound room at your local HiFi boutique, or at Magnolia, or your friends house will be different. But the main features of a driver from 300Hz to 8kHz will come through pretty well via a quality well made microphone recording.
You could take the speaker, put it in an anechoic chamber, use a B&K preciison mic and preamp. You still have the amp the source, youtube and all the uncontrollable stuff at the receiving end. Too much is lost/buried to really know.

My guess is that the Genelecs use a lot of DSP and steep crossovers with phase wrap. That can cause fatigue as well as amps that have too much higher odd order distortion. Or a voicing that doesn’t tilt down to the right - aka Harman “house curve”. Circa -5dB less at 20kHz vs 50Hz. But phase artifacts from steep DSP crossovers have ringing in the impulse response. We subconsciously hear this as fatigue.
True, I do buy into the listener’s fatigue affected by the phase not being right.
But many full range drivers, the phase slowly can slowly wrap pretty far also (lows vs highs).
